Purchase, NY… The College of New Jersey field hockey team netted a pair of goals in each half as the Lions won their fourth straight game to start the year with a 4-0 shutout at Manhattanville College on Tuesday.
The win keeps the 17th-ranked Lions undefeated on the season at 4-0, while the Valiants dipped to 0-2.
TCNJ opened the scoring 13:32 into the game as sophomore Camille Passucci (Denville, NJ/Morris Knolls) notched her second goal in as many games as she knocked in a pass from senior Kellyn Riley (Cherry Hill, NJ/Cherry West) on a penalty corner.
Riley then made it a 2-0 game at the 17:02 mark with an unassisted goal.
In the second half, the Lions used a pair of quick goals to double their advantage as sophomore Jillian Nealon (Whitehouse Station, NJ/Hunterdon Central) deflected in a shot by junior Leigh Mitchell (Mt. Laurel, NJ/Lenape). Senior Jessica Falcone (Cherry Hill, NJ/Camden Catholic) recorded TCNJ's fourth goal with an assist from classmate Mary Waller (Bel Air, MD/C. Milton Wright). Nealon's goal came with 2:37 expired in the new half, while Falcone's came 2:05 later.
Junior goalie Shannon Syciarz (Garwood, NJ/Arthur L. Johnson) picked up her second shutout of the season with having to face a shot on goal.
TCNJ is idle until Saturday when they head to Fairleigh Dickinson University – Florham for a 5:30 p.m. start against the Devils.
